No. | 質問・回答 | おれい |
|
[59794] index.htmlとindex.htm・・・ |
|
|
現在HPを製作中なのですが、
[index.html]と[index.htm]は拡張子が違うため同じディレクトリに入りますよね。
では、サーバーにUPしたときに、最後が[~****/]で終わっていた場合、どちらが表示されるでしょうか。教えてください。お願いします。
ayu 2005年3月3日22:12
|
|
|
|
[59796] |
DOS時代に、拡張子は3文字までという制限があった名残で現在も使われています。
ただ、海外も含めたHP上のルール(一般常識?)はhtmlが採用されています。
個人サイトでhtmのところもあります。
ただ、特に指定をしなければ、htmlが優先されるかと思います。
サポ太 (225) 2005年3月3日22:15
|
+2 p
|
|
|
[59799] |
す、すごい・・・わずか三分でレスが付くとは・・・
index.htmlが優先されるんですね。サポ太さんありがとうございます。
ayu 2005年3月3日22:21
|
|
|
|
[59800] |
はじめまして。Gusohです。
私も多分*.HTMLの方が優先されるのではないかと思いますが...
あー、でもサーバーで設定が違うかも...
長いことHTMLも書いてますが気がつきませんでした。
一番いいのは実際に二つ作ってみて試すことです。
ファイルをアップロードしたところでサーバーは壊れませんし、百聞は一見にしかずともいいます。
やってみるとおもしろいと思います。
その暁にはぜひ報告してくださいな。
大変に興味をそそられます。
gusoh (33) 2005年3月3日22:22
|
|
|
|
[59823] |
htmlとhtmのどちらが優先されるかというのは、HTTPサーバの設定次第にかかわってきます。
つまり、設定次第ではどちらでも優先にできる、また、index.html以外でも優先にさせることができるのです。
いい例が、WindowsのHTTPサーバとして多く使われているInternet Information Service(通称、IIS)です。
これは、デフォルトで「default.htm」が優先されるように設定されています。
ちなみに一般的に多く利用されている、「Apache」と呼ばれているHTTPサーバがあります。
こちらのデフォルト設定は、「index.html」が優先されています。
ドワーフ (747) 2005年3月4日08:52
|
+2 p
|
|
|
[59928] |
>index.htmlが優先されるんですね。サポ太さんありがとうございます。
これは明らかに間違いです。
ドワーフ さんがご指摘のように、これはサーバの設定で変わります。
index.html→index.htm の優先度とすることもできますし、index.htm のみにすることもできます(その場合は、index.htmlは利用されません)
また、他のファイル(default.htmやindex.php,...)にすることもできます。
通常は、HPの説明に書かれていますが、わからない場合は管理者に確認してください。
>海外も含めたHP上のルール(一般常識?)はhtmlが採用されています。
決してHP上のルールではないということを理解してください。
maido (2696) 2005年3月5日22:27
|
+2 p
|
|
|
[59933] |
要するにこういうことですよね。
・大体はindex.htmlが優先される。
・しかし、設定により優先度は変わる。
・サーバーにもよって優先度は違う。
余談ですが・・・
>一番いいのは実際に二つ作ってみて試すことです。
ということで、僕が使うgeocitiesで実験すると、index.htmlが優先されました。
皆さんレスどうもありがとうございました。
ayu 2005年3月6日00:58
|
|
|
|
[59940] |
>個人サイトでhtmのところもあります。
ただ、特に指定をしなければ、htmlが優先されるかと思います。
たしかに、言葉が足りませんでしたね。
以後、気をつけます。
サポ太 (225) 2005年3月6日08:25
|
|
|
|
( 参照数:1869 日平均:0.3 ) |
|
〜 回答の受付を終了しました 〜 |